Year 1 Academic year: 2024/25, Starting in: September

Notes:
Jewellery & Silversmithing Core Courses DESI08143 and DESI08144 must be passed to progress to Year 2.

To continue without the need for an extension to the total period of study, a full-time student must attain a minimum of 80 credit points by the end of Year 1. Total credits per year must equal 120.

Year 2 Academic year: 2024/25, Starting in: August

Notes:
Jewellery & Silversmithing Core Courses DESI08145 and DESI08146 must be passed to progress to Year 3.

To continue without the need for an extension to the total period of study, a full-time student must attain a minimum of 200 credit points by the end of Year 2. Total credits per year must equal 120.

Year 3 Academic year: 2024/25, Starting in: August

Notes:
To continue without the need for an extension to the total period of study, a full-time student must attain a minimum of 360 credit points by the end of Year 3. In

Semester 2, students may opt to take DESI10132 Work-Based Placement: Reflecting on Design Professions (40 credits) in place of DESI09097 Design Externality Major Jewellery & Silversmithing Semester 2 (40 credits). This course can only be taken when a placement has been agreed with your Programme Director and the Course Organiser.

After successful completion of 360 credits as outlined above, students may be eligible to exit with an Ordinary degree. See general DRPS regulation 53 for further details.

Year 4 Academic year: 2024/25, Starting in: August

Notes:
To continue without the need for an extension to the total period of study, a full-time student must attain a minimum of 480 credit points by the end of Year 4.

With the permission of the School of Design, Students may opt to take DESI10053 Design & Screen Cultures 4 (Extended) (40 credits) in place of DESI10052 Design & Screen Cultures 4 (20 credits) and replacing DESI10031 Design Research 4 (Jewellery & Silversmithing) (40 credits) with DESI10015 Design Research 4 (20-credit option - Jewellery & Silversmithing)
